Last week Matt and Jonathan discussed the primary task of a pastor - preaching the word of God. This week they continue walking through the essential tasks of a pastor by addressing the first of the two sacraments: baptism.


What is baptism? Why did Jesus command that we baptize people? Does God do something in a person when they are baptized? Why do Anglicans see a comparison between circumcision in the Old Covenant and baptism in the New Covenant? And, last of all, why do we baptize children of believing parents?
